WestportObservatory@vmst.io ("Westport Observatory") wrote:

There's been a supernova and WAS astrophotographer Carl Lancaster has the before and after of this star blowing it's guts out into the universe, erupting in "nearby" galaxy NGC 7331, 40 million light-years away in the constellation Pegasus. Officially known as SN 2025rbs, it is a type 1A supernova, a type of supernova that occurs in binary systems in which one of the stars is a white dwarf. #SN2025rbs #Supernova #WestportAstronomicalSociety

SpindleyQ@gamemaking.social ("Spindley Q Frog") wrote:

came across COMFY-65 the other day, I forget how. https://oneofus.la/have-emacs-will-hack/files/sigcol04.pdf

It's a compile-to-6502 assembly language implemented in emacs lisp, with the main thing it provides over raw assembly being structured flow control. (of course you can just use lisp as a macro assembler too, that comes for free.) uses an extremely neat trick of emitting code _backwards_ so that it always has enough context to generate the most efficient branch instructions in a single pass. extremely my shit.

dalias@hachyderm.io ("Cassandrich") wrote:

PSA: On stock mobile Firefox, you can bypass Mozilla's lockout of about:config using the alternate URL:

chrome://geckoview/content/config.xhtml

Note that "chrome" here has nothing to do with the Google browser. Google stole the name from what was previously the Mozilla-internal name for "browser UI components".

wohali@timeloop.cafe wrote:

RIP Tom Lehrer, a man whose music helped me see through political bullshit when I was just a kid as clearly as seeing the craters on the Moon through a brand new telescope.

Wikipedia has a bunch of great stories about him. This one was new to me:

In 2012, rapper 2 Chainz sampled Lehrer's song "The Old Dope Peddler", on his 2012 debut album, Based on a T.R.U. Story. In 2013, Lehrer said he was "very proud" to have his song sampled "literally sixty years after I recorded it". Lehrer went on to describe his official response to the request to use his song: "As sole copyright owner of 'The Old Dope Peddler', I grant you motherfuckers permission to do this. Please give my regards to Mr. Chainz, or may I call him 2?"
